Well, based upon advice at egullet.com, I hit Roosevelt Tavern for some lunch. People rave about their 1. low prices; and 2. burgers.

Both ARE worth raving about! If you buy a drink, burger/fry combo is 2.95, .50 for any toppings like cheese, mushrooms, etc. And they are nice-sized - perfect for lunch.

The meat patty must be from a tasty cut of beef, and it's seasoned well, because it is soooo flavorful - this is one burger I'd enjoy almost as much as plain as with cheese!

It's located on the Southeast corner of 23rd and Walnut - within walking distance of Center City. Just a regular pub/tavern - they are currently remodeling.

If you need a fix when you are in Philly, this should hit the spot!
